Molotov TV is the French IPTV service that launched in 2016 and was acquired in 2021 by US operator FuboTV. It aggregates more than 80 French channels live and on catch-up (TF1, France Télévisions, M6, BFM TV and others), with cloud DVR and time-shift on the paid tiers. Three plans are offered: a free Molotov tier plus two paid options that layer on extra channels and premium film content. Registered accounts now sit above 20 million.

Company and history
Major changes
Molotov launched in France as a free app that bundled dozens of TNT channels into one interface, adding live TV, cloud recording, and a start-over feature that let you rewind to the beginning of a program.
The service rolled out paid Molotov Plus and Extended tiers, layering extra channels, multiple simultaneous screens, and larger recording storage on top of the free base, turning the app into a full subscription product.
US operator FuboTV acquired Molotov for roughly 164 million euros. The deal was Fubo's first move into the European market and gave Molotov the financial backing of a much larger streaming partner.
Disney announced its intent to take a 70 percent stake in Fubo and merge it with Hulu + Live TV. The agreement opened a path for Molotov toward deeper collaboration with Disney across international markets.
Molotov signed a non-exclusive carriage deal for Ligue 1 covering the 2025/2026 season, becoming the first streaming platform to offer France's top football league alongside regular channels inside a single ecosystem.
Fubo completed its combination with Hulu + Live TV under Disney control, forming one of the largest pay-TV providers in the US with nearly six million subscribers. Molotov remained its flagship European brand.
Molotov sharply cut its annual subscription prices, with the Extra tier dropping to around forty euros a year and Extended to sixty, the equivalent of roughly six months free compared with paying month by month.
